Visitors are consistently captivated by the serene beauty and the impressive sculptures at the museum, particularly noting the tranquility it offers in the heart of the city. The gardens are frequently highlighted as sublime, providing a perfect backdrop for the art pieces. While the indoor spaces can get crowded, making it challenging to fully enjoy the exhibits, the overall experience is enriched by special exhibitions and the historical ambiance of the venue.

Summary

The Musée Rodin, located in Paris, France, is a renowned art museum dedicated to the works of French sculptor Auguste Rodin. Opened in 1919, the museum is situated across two sites: the Hôtel Biron in central Paris and the Villa des Brillants at Meudon, just outside Paris, which was Rodin's old home. The museum houses a vast collection of 6,600 sculptures, 8,000 drawings, 8,000 old photographs, and 7,000 objets d'art, attracting 700,000 visitors annually. The museum showcases Rodin's significant creations, including The Thinker, The Kiss, and The Gates of Hell, many of which are displayed in the museum's extensive garden. It also includes a room dedicated to the works of Camille Claudel, Rodin's student, collaborator, and lover. Rodin used the Hôtel Biron as his workshop from 1908 and later donated his entire collection of sculptures, along with paintings by Vincent van Gogh, Claude Monet, and Pierre-Auguste Renoir, to the French State on the condition that they turn the buildings into a museum dedicated to his works. The museum also hosts temporary exhibitions and contemporary art exhibitions. The building is easily accessible via Métro (Line 13), RER (Line C: Invalides), and bus (69, 82, 87, 92). The Musée Rodin offers a unique opportunity to appreciate Rodin's artistic genius and his contribution to the art world.
